**FAQ: Why did the Stockpilot restock planner stop generating routes?**

Stockpilot halts route generation whenever its demand-forecast snapshot is older than 48 hours, which usually happens after a failed overnight import from the Carvell telemetry feed. For the release manager: do not ship a hotfix for this; it is a safety stop, not a bug. Instead, rerun the import manually from the planner console, which requires the recovery passphrase below.

recovery phrase for bawif-yawif: gorwyn-kelix-zorox-silath-novix-juleth

Item 12 — InkLedger PDF invoice renderer signing ceremony. Before plugin certification begins, confirm the renderer's master signing key has been generated on the offline machine and the ceremony witnessed by two Brindlecore staff. Plugin authors: your extension bundles will later be verified against this key. Store your copy of the ceremony record securely; it includes the recovery passphrase shown below.

unlock words, yawig-kagef: gordor-holvan-ulaael-pramir-ulaiel-tamdor

**Service Accounts — Importomatic CSV Wizard**

The wizard runs under the `importomatic-svc` account. It needs read access to the staging bucket and write access to Rowhaven. Don't use your personal account for batch jobs. Rotation happens quarterly; ops handles it. For local testing against the Rowhaven sandbox, authenticate with the key below.

service key, fawip-bajef: kto11_Qt5wZK9vdNC

When restoring a locked merchant account, remember that the Harborlight catalog keeps per-account caches keyed by merchant ID. After recovery, those entries are stale and will serve the pre-lock product list for up to two hours. Always run `catalog-purge` with the merchant ID immediately after reactivation, then confirm the listing refresh in the Lintel dashboard. New team members: do not skip the purge even if listings look correct. To authorize the purge tool, enter the recovery passphrase shown below.

unlock words, hahip-baduf: holwyn-istath-julvan